The benchmark index moderated by 31.13 points (-1.29%) to close at 2,419.49 with a -5.94% year-to-date return due to losses in four counters in the banking, insurance and telecom sectors. Market capitalization declined by 0.52% to settle at GH¢59.40 billion.
Sector indices trended lower. The GSE-FI shed 12.73 points (-0.60%) to close with a -0.93% YTD return while the SAS-MI remained at yesterday’s level of 4,600.02 to close with a -1.14% YTD return.
Trading activity weakened, with 83,643 shares valued at GH¢55,416 changing hands from 133,824 shares valued at GH¢118,117 at the previous session. Cal Bank Limited (CAL) dominated trades by both volume and value, accounting for 37.21% of total volume traded and 53.08% of total value traded.
We expect trading activity to increase as companies continue to release 2018 full year earnings results.
